Glossary
Australian Equivalents to International Reporting
Standards (A-IFRS)
Australian Securities and Investments Commission (ASIC)
Australian Securities Exchange (ASX)
Annual General Meeting (AGM)
Available Seat Kilometres (ASKs)
Total number of seats available for passengers, multiplied by the number
of kilometres flown.
Available Tonne Kilometres (ATKs)
Total number of tonnes of capacity available for carriage of passengers,
freight and mail, multiplied by the number of kilometres flown.
Carbon Dioxide (CO2)
A colourless, odourless, incombustible gas formed during respiration,
combustion and organic decomposition, and is the most prominent
greenhouse gas in the earth’s atmosphere.
Emissions shown in the Report have been calculated for ground
and aviation fuel.
Fuel Jettison
Emergency release of fuel to reduce the weight of the aircraft to
the maximum landing weight.
Fuel Spills
The accidental spillage of aviation fuel material at airport sites.
Goods and Services Tax (GST)
International Air Transport Association (IATA)
Lost Time Injury (LTI)
A work related injury (or illness) that resulted in a fatality, permanent
disability or the loss from work of one day or shift or more.
Lost Time Injury Frequency Rate (LTIFR)
The number of LTIs per million hours worked.
Nitrogen Oxide (NOX)
The generic term for a group of highly reactive gases, all of which contain
nitrogen and oxygen in varying amounts. NOx is formed when fuel is
burned at high temperatures, as occurs in the combustion process.
Passenger Yield
Passenger revenue, excluding passenger recoveries, divided by RPKs.
Revenue Freight Tonne Kilometres (RFTKs)
Total number of tonnes of paying freight carried, multiplied by the number
of kilometres flown.
Revenue Passenger Kilometres (RPKs)
Total number of paying passengers carried, multiplied by the number
of kilometres flown.
Revenue Seat Factor
Percentage of total passenger capacity actually utilised by
paying passengers.
Revenue Tonne Kilometres (RTKs)
Total number of tonnes of paying passengers, freight and mail carried,
multiplied by the number of kilometres flown.
Sustainable Future Program (SFP)
Turnover of Full-Time Equivalent Employees
Total number of employee terminations expressed as a percentage
of total FTEs.
